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82 73075967 0481 0682
657 45830594979
657 45830594979
9954 633 5538845115 6657268954
All about undefined
Interested in learning more?
657 45830594979
9954 633 5538845115 6657268954
See more
2991 199559958
67964945 423634100 954
See more
295939 5301767266 24349110
35652 7103768 65542
See more